logo

Output 1189f31a96ef9e538b020ffe264c9f407792a36579cc09770e088e91289d7786:0

value
2168162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24cb1adba00b88f2d1103538dd1e20e484d33ffe OP_EQUAL
address
353ZZRgqpm8TEHb8zwjzuH34ohm4T3w3cG
transaction
1189f31a96ef9e538b020ffe264c9f407792a36579cc09770e088e91289d7786